Oba-elect of Odo-Nla, Olowolekomoh Loses Mom

Posted on February 16, 2023

The Oba-elect of Odo Nla kingdom-Ikorodu, Lagos, Prince Olusoga Elias Adeyemi Olowolekomoh has lost his mother, Alhaja Falilat Titilayo Ebun Alake Olowolekomoh.

She passed away at the age of 75, on February 13, 2023 and was buried the next day, February 14, according to Islamic rites at number 6, Oremolu Street, Ikorodu, Lagos.

The Fidua prayers will be held for her on February 21 at the same venue between 12 noon and 2pm.

It would be recalled that Olowolekomoh emerged the Oba-elect of Odo-Nla kingdom last December among other five contestants to the ancient throne from the Ogbodo and Raselu ruling houses respectively contested for the royal crown.

It was a painstaking and thorough exercise that produced Olowolekomoh as revealed by Asiwaju Otunba David Ekiyoyo, the Olootu Oba Meta in a signed statement.
